Did you know that May 22 is the International Day for Biological Diversity? It’s a special day when people all around the world celebrate the amazing variety of life on Earth! This year’s theme is “Harmony with Nature and Sustainable Development.” Sounds cool, right?
Today, let’s dive into the crystal-clear waters of Sansha City, located in Hainan Province on the Chinese mainland. Sansha City is a unique place surrounded by the stunning South China Sea. It’s home to an incredible marine ecosystem filled with colorful coral reefs, playful dolphins, and mysterious sea turtles! 🐬🐢
Imagine swimming alongside schools of bright fish, exploring underwater gardens of coral, and discovering creatures you’ve never seen before. The ocean here is like a giant aquarium, but even better because it’s real life!
But wait, why is biodiversity so important? Well, every plant and animal plays a special role in keeping our planet healthy. In Sansha City’s waters, the coral reefs provide homes for fish, which in turn help keep the ocean clean. It’s a big circle of life where everything is connected!
Protecting places like Sansha City helps ensure that future generations can enjoy these natural wonders too. By learning about and respecting nature, we can all help keep the balance. Maybe one day, you might visit and see these amazing sights for yourself!
